How they compare

Turkey currently reports 512,000 against 463,000 in Myanmar, a difference of 49,000.

That makes Turkey's figure about 1.1 times Myanmar's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 33 shared years of data; in 1985 it was Turkey ahead.

Myanmar ranks 14th and Turkey ranks 13th of 173 countries.

Armed forces personnel are active duty military personnel, including paramilitary forces if their training, organization, equipment, and control suggest they may be used to support or replace regular military forces.
